Pacemaker Implant, Upper And Lower Chambers

Wyoming rates for HCPCS 33208

Implants a permanent pacemaker, threading leads through a vein into both the upper and the lower chamber on the right side of the heart, with the battery unit placed under the skin below the collarbone. Pacing both chambers keeps them timed together the way the heart normally works. It treats a heartbeat that is too slow or that pauses.

How much does Pacemaker Implant, Upper And Lower Chambers cost?

$1,318

Typical physician fee. In Wyoming,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$1,318 for this service. Most negotiated rates run $1,318 to $1,585.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 4 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
